Victoria records two new local cases of COVID-19 – The Age
There were two new local cases of COVID-19 reported in Victoria in the past day and four in hotel quarantine.
Victoria has recorded two new local cases of coronavirus in the past day. Both are primary close contacts of existing cases, with no community exposure during their infectious period.
